XiiaLive - Radio Reference APK Description
XiiaLive Plugin
Expand your XiiaLive experience with the world's largest radio communications data provider. RadioReference is the largest broadcaster of public safety live audio communications feeds, hosting thousands of live audio broadcasts of Police, Fire, EMS, Railroad, and aircraft communications.
With hundreds of thousands of members, RadioReference is a world leading collaboration platform for public safety communications professionals and hobbyists.
Supported countries:
United States, Canada, Australia, Chile, Germany, Ireland, Switzerland, United Kingdom, Italy, Spain, Slovenia, Bulgaria, Argentina, Antigua and Barbuda, Netherlands, Czech Republic, France, Denmark, Indonesia, Greece, Norway, and New Zealand.
